Cindy Gail Dickson, 55, a lifelong resident of Chattanooga, died on Tuesday, November 25, 2014.

She was a Jefferson Award winner and a teacher/volunteer of White Oak Elementary School. Cindy devoted her life teaching and helping educate children, specializing with hearing impaired children.  She was at her best when she was helping others or going on one on her many trips.

Cindy was preceded in death by her grandparents, Mr. and Mrs. David A. Bain and Mr. and Mrs. Ernest L. Dickson; grandmother, Mary Shinbahm; sister, Donna Dickson-Azari; cousin, Donald Kris Bain and uncle David A. Bain, Jr.

Survivors are her mother, Deloris Dickson; father, Sydney Dickson and wife Connie Dickson; sisters, Angela D. DeMarcus and Teresa D. Dampier; nephew, Jason Dickson; nieces, Erica Azari-Elayan, Jena Pinson, Kaitlyn DeMarcus, Kaylee Smith and Layla Elayan; aunt, Beverly Bain of Houston; cousins, Greta Bain, Ingrid Lee and Kim Wright of Houston; uncle and aunt, Donald and Tressa Bain and many other cousins and friends, especially lifelong friend, Paulene Davis.

She will be deeply missed by all who knew and loved her. Her memory and inspiration will live on in the lives of those she loved and touched.
